Transaction 58d7b14f7ef166367682f8ca686351a428e494b363a02c0c4bcd1c30271f6d18
1 Input
1 Output
-
58d7b14f7ef166367682f8ca686351a428e494b363a02c0c4bcd1c30271f6d18:0
- value
- 10998663
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c67ccd668974cf9153a78e2ab59485927f519060 OP_EQUAL
- address
- 3KnXDwmrnqgueodqMPvjM9Zdu1F12Yebkf